The Cultural Resource Group of Louis Berger & Associates, Inc. (LBA)
is seeking an archaeologist to fill a postion opening in our Midwest
Regional Office.  This is a full-time, salaried position, not a project
appointment.  We are looking for a highly motivated individual to pursue
quality archaeological research in a Cultural Resource Management
context.  The successful applicant will serve as Archaeologist/Principal
Investigator and will have primary responsibility for the design and
implementation of archaeological reconnaissance surveys and
archaeological site evaluation projects.
 
Applicants must have a graduate degree in archaeology or anthropology
and at least one year of supervisory work experience, preferably associated
 
with Section 106 compliance projects.  Applications from both prehistoric
and historic period specialists will be considered; however, applicants
with
previous experience in the Midwest or eastern Plains regions are preferred.
All applicants should be prepared to demonstrate that they have strong
written and verbal communication skills and a working knowledge of
historic preservation law.
 
The successful applicant must be willing to relocate to the Marion/Cedar
Rapids
metropolitan area (pop. 150,000) and must be able to travel for project
assignments. Competitive salaries are offered commensurate with experience.
Employment benefits include vacation, sick leave, holidays,
medical/dental/life/disability insurance, retirement plan and 401K. EOE.
